Here's the revised description with bullets and bolded subheadings:
You are a seasoned engineer with a passion for pushing the boundaries of technology.
With 8-15 years of experience, you bring a wealth of knowledge in software architecture and leadership.
You excel in C/C++ software development, and your strong background in design patterns, data structures, and algorithms sets you apart.
You thrive in multi-threaded and distributed code environments, and your familiarity with ASIC design flow and EDA tools is second to none. Your expertise in Verilog, SystemVerilog, and VHDL HDL, coupled with your experience in Unix/Linux platforms, makes you a valuable asset. You are well-versed in developer tools like gdb and Valgrind, and you understand the importance of source code control tools such as Perforce.
Your analytical and problem-solving skills are top-notch, and you are always eager to learn and explore new technologies.
As a highly enthusiastic and energetic team player, you are ready to go the extra mile to achieve success.
What You'll Be Doing:
- Designing, developing, and troubleshooting core algorithms for word-level synthesis.
- Collaborating with local and global teams to enhance synthesis QoR, performance, and logic interference.
- Engaging in pure technical roles focused on software development and architecture.
- Implementing multi-threaded and distributed code solutions.
- Utilizing your knowledge of ASIC design flow and EDA tools to drive innovation.
- Leveraging your expertise in Verilog, SystemVerilog, and VHDL HDL to develop cutting-edge solutions.
The Impact You Will Have:
- Driving technological innovation in chip design and verification.
- Enhancing the performance and quality of synthesis tools used globally.
- Solving complex logic interference problems to improve design accuracy.
- Contributing to the development of high-performance silicon chips and software content.
- Collaborating with cross-functional teams to achieve project milestones.
- Pioneering new software architectures that set industry standards.
What You'll Need:
- Strong hands-on experience in C/C++ based software development.
- Deep understanding of design patterns, data structures, algorithms, and programming concepts.
- Familiarity with multi-threaded and distributed code development.
- Knowledge of ASIC design flow and EDA tools and methodologies.
- Proficiency in Verilog, SystemVerilog, and VHDL HDL.